**CI note: timezone weirdness in report exports**

Heads up, support folks — if a customer says their Ledgerpine export shows times shifted by a few hours, it's probably the CI image. The export workers got rebuilt last week and the base image defaults to UTC, while older workers used the account's locale. Fix is rolling out; meanwhile tell customers the data itself is fine, just the display offset. Affected exports carry the build token shown below.

build token for bajof-tahop: htk4_a981

# Service Accounts — Partition Roller

The `svc-partroll` account handles monthly table partitioning for the Ledgerline warehouse. On the first of each month it creates the next partition, attaches it, and drops anything past the 13-month retention window. It runs under restricted DDL scope only. For the weekly sync: rotation happened last Tuesday, no failures since. The account authenticates to the internal Slabgate API using the key below.

API key for yahig-tadup: kto7_ubizbYm

**Internal Memo — Brackenhall Systems**

To sales leads: the board has approved the sale of our Fieldline Instruments unit to Quorath Holdings. Closing is expected within two months. Existing Fieldline customer contracts transfer with the unit; commissions on open deals will be honoured through handover. Direct customer questions to your regional lead until then. Strategic context for the sale follows below.

internal memo for kawip-hadug: Headcount on the Wenwyn team goes from 7 to 140 by the end of January. Gross margin on Wenwyn came in at 20 percent against a plan of 15 percent.